CeeDee Lamb Reveals His Mindset Heading Into Playoffs

The Dallas Cowboys have just suffered a devastating loss to the Arizona Cardinals. However, wide receiver CeeDee lamb isn’t losing faith in his team.

The Cowboys second-year wideout, speaking to reporters on Tuesday, stated that he believes they are only a few mistakes away from returning to the position they were in earlier this season.

“We haven’t played our best yet. That is what I believe. It’s true. It’s not much more than a few miscues here or there. … We are still trying to get back up to the level we were, but we have the playoffs. I’m excited.”

Lamb’s Week 17 performance was disappointing, with just three passes for 51 yard. He has more than 1,000 yards receiving and six touchdowns so far this season.

Although the Cowboys won four of their five previous games, they aren’t as dominant as October.

Dallas has one remaining game on its regular season schedule, which allows it to resolve any offense issues.

ESPN will broadcast the Cowboys vs Eagles matchup on Saturday.
